Did a terrific ride down to Abingdon VA - the excuse was to have dinner at the oldest continually operating bar in VA.  843 mile weekend of mostly back roads from Northern VA down to the TN border.  A hot 150 miles on route 29 coming home was the only downside.

All the roads were good, but memorable was 61 into Tazwell; 16 (Back of the Dragon); 42 to Saltville; Sunday morning, 58 to Hillsville; 221 to near Roanoke; 419 to 220; etc.

Good weekend on a good bike.

Image was on the Blue Ridge Parkway vicinity Roanoke.

Great pavement and little traffic on 16 this weekend.  We rode out from an MSTA event in Sparta.  It was part of a 260 mile loop in which 16 was not the twistiest road (Burke's Garden Rd. was).
